About The Project

Orthophotos provide a high-precision data foundation for various applications in remote sensing – from environmental research to urban planning. However, Germany's federal structure means that each state has its own services and interfaces for providing this data, making nationwide usage cumbersome and complex.

With this software, we offer a central, user-friendly solution that allows users to download orthophotos independently of the respective state services. The software will support various data formats, including RGB and RGBI, and enable flexible geographical queries.

Getting Started

  1. Clone the repo
    git clone https://github.com/ffe-munich/orthophotos-downloader.git
    
  2. Setup a venv with python > 3.9
    python3.11 -m  venv "venv" 
    source venv/bin/activate
    
  3. Pip install
    pip install .
